C# Класс Edu.Nlu.Sir.Siemens.Replace.IReplace

Показать файл Открыть проект

Открытые методы

Метод Описание
Caseerror ( int n ) : void
Main ( char args ) : void
addstr ( char c, char &outset, int &j, int maxset ) : bool
amatch ( char lin, int offset, char pat, int j ) : int
change ( char pat, char sub ) : void
dodash ( char delim, char src, int &i, char dest, int &j, int maxset ) : void
esc ( char s, int &i ) : char
getccl ( char arg, int &i, char pat, int &j ) : bool
getline ( char &s, int maxsize ) : bool
getpat ( char arg, char &pat ) : bool
getsub ( char arg, char &sub ) : bool
in_pat_set ( char c ) : bool
in_set_2 ( char c ) : bool
locate ( char c, char pat, int offset ) : bool
makepat ( char arg, int start, char delim, char &pat ) : int
makesub ( char arg, int from, char delim, char &sub ) : int
omatch ( char lin, int &i, char pat, int j ) : bool
patsize ( char pat, int n ) : int
putsub ( char lin, int s1, int s2, char sub ) : void
stclose ( char pat, int &j, int lastj ) : void
subline ( char lin, char pat, char sub ) : void

Описание методов

Caseerror() публичный абстрактный Метод

public abstract Caseerror ( int n ) : void
n int
Результат void

Main() публичный абстрактный Метод

public abstract Main ( char args ) : void
args char
Результат void

addstr() публичный абстрактный Метод

public abstract addstr ( char c, char &outset, int &j, int maxset ) : bool
c char
outset char
j int
maxset int
Результат bool

amatch() публичный абстрактный Метод

public abstract amatch ( char lin, int offset, char pat, int j ) : int
lin char
offset int
pat char
j int
Результат int

change() публичный абстрактный Метод

public abstract change ( char pat, char sub ) : void
pat char
sub char
Результат void

dodash() публичный абстрактный Метод

public abstract dodash ( char delim, char src, int &i, char dest, int &j, int maxset ) : void
delim char
src char
i int
dest char
j int
maxset int
Результат void

esc() публичный абстрактный Метод

public abstract esc ( char s, int &i ) : char
s char
i int
Результат char

getccl() публичный абстрактный Метод

public abstract getccl ( char arg, int &i, char pat, int &j ) : bool
arg char
i int
pat char
j int
Результат bool

getline() публичный абстрактный Метод

public abstract getline ( char &s, int maxsize ) : bool
s char
maxsize int
Результат bool

getpat() публичный абстрактный Метод

public abstract getpat ( char arg, char &pat ) : bool
arg char
pat char
Результат bool

getsub() публичный абстрактный Метод

public abstract getsub ( char arg, char &sub ) : bool
arg char
sub char
Результат bool

in_pat_set() публичный абстрактный Метод

public abstract in_pat_set ( char c ) : bool
c char
Результат bool

in_set_2() публичный абстрактный Метод

public abstract in_set_2 ( char c ) : bool
c char
Результат bool

locate() публичный абстрактный Метод

public abstract locate ( char c, char pat, int offset ) : bool
c char
pat char
offset int
Результат bool

makepat() публичный абстрактный Метод

public abstract makepat ( char arg, int start, char delim, char &pat ) : int
arg char
start int
delim char
pat char
Результат int

makesub() публичный абстрактный Метод

public abstract makesub ( char arg, int from, char delim, char &sub ) : int
arg char
from int
delim char
sub char
Результат int

omatch() публичный абстрактный Метод

public abstract omatch ( char lin, int &i, char pat, int j ) : bool
lin char
i int
pat char
j int
Результат bool

patsize() публичный абстрактный Метод

public abstract patsize ( char pat, int n ) : int
pat char
n int
Результат int

putsub() публичный абстрактный Метод

public abstract putsub ( char lin, int s1, int s2, char sub ) : void
lin char
s1 int
s2 int
sub char
Результат void

stclose() публичный абстрактный Метод

public abstract stclose ( char pat, int &j, int lastj ) : void
pat char
j int
lastj int
Результат void

subline() публичный абстрактный Метод

public abstract subline ( char lin, char pat, char sub ) : void
lin char
pat char
sub char
Результат void